Kawalpura

Kawalpura is a village located in Mashrakh subdivision of Saran district in Bihar, India. It is situated 9km away from sub-district headquarter Mashrakh (tehsildar office) and 50km away from district headquarter Chhapra. As per 2009 stats, Kawalpura village is also a gram panchayat.

About Kawalpura

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Kawalpura is 232828. The village spans a total geographical area of 304 hectares. Chapra is nearest town to Kawalpura village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 61km away.

Population of Kawalpura

Below is a concise population overview of Kawalpura as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 3,918 1,906 2,012
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 586 302 284
Scheduled Castes (SC) 181 89 92
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 7 5 2
Literate Population 2,215 1,273 942
Illiterate Population 1,703 633 1,070

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Kawalpura village:

  • The total population of Kawalpura village is around 3,918, including approximately 1,906 males and 2,012 females, with a sex ratio of 1055 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 586 children aged 0–6 years in Kawalpura village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Kawalpura village has 181 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 7 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Kawalpura village is about 56.53%, with male literacy at 66.79% and female literacy at 46.82%.
  • There are around 605 households in Kawalpura village.

Connectivity of Kawalpura

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Kawalpura. As per the 2011 stats, Kawalpura had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within village
Private Bus Service Available within village
Railway Station Available within 5 - 10 km distance
